Security Solutions Engineer

HOOPP (Healthcare of Ontario Pension Plan)Toronto, ON

About The Position

The Security Solutions Engineer plays a critical role in securing HOOPP’s IT environment and supporting HOOPP’s business objectives. This role is a senior technical contributor within the Information Security Operations team, responsible for designing, implementing, and operating security controls across on-premises and cloud environments, with a strong focus on AWS, network security, and security operations. The successful candidate will bring hands-on experience working in a Security Operations environment, supporting incident response at a senior (Level 3) capacity, and collaborating closely with Infrastructure, Cloud, and IT teams. While experience with SIEM technologies is important, this role requires a well-rounded security engineer with strong fundamentals across cloud, network, endpoint, and email security. The role also requires a working knowledge of application security concepts to effectively partner with Infrastructure and Application teams and support investigations involving application-layer threats.

Requirements

  • 7+ years of experience in IT infrastructure and security, including 5+ years in Security Operations or Information Security roles, with strong hands-on experience securing AWS environments (Azure experience is a plus).
  • Proven experience supporting incident response in an enterprise environment, including investigation, containment, remediation, and post-incident analysis.
  • Strong experience working in Security Operations (SecOps) environments and operating security tooling such as SIEM/log management, email security, endpoint detection and response (EDR), and vulnerability management platforms.
  • Deep understanding of network and network security concepts, including TCP/IP, firewalls, routing, segmentation, and troubleshooting in hybrid and cloud environments.
  • Hands-on experience securing cloud-native and hybrid environments across IaaS, PaaS, and SaaS.
  • Strong knowledge of identity and access management, including Entra ID, Active Directory, and modern authentication protocols (OAuth, SAML, PKI).
  • Familiarity with CI/CD pipelines, deployment workflows, and associated security controls.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Cybersecurity, Computer Science, Information Security, Information Technology, Computer Engineering, or a related field (or equivalent practical experience).
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with the ability to operate effectively in high-pressure, incident-driven situations.
  • Excellent communication skills with both technical and non-technical audiences.
  • Self-motivated, collaborative, and able to think strategically and architecturally.

Nice To Haves

  • Working knowledge of emerging technologies and associated security risks, including AI platforms, is considered an asset.
  • Professional security or cloud certifications are an asset but not required (e.g., CISSP, CCSP, CISA, SSCP).

Responsibilities

  • Security Operations & Incident Response Act as a senior escalation point for complex security incidents, providing deep technical analysis, containment, and remediation guidance.
  • Lead and support incident response activities, including investigations, root cause analysis, and post-incident reviews.
  • Improve detection, response, and alerting capabilities across security tools and platforms.
  • Analyze logs, alerts, and telemetry from security tools, cloud platforms, infrastructure, and network devices.
  • Provide support to SOC on-call staff for security events and incidents as required.
  • Architecture, Strategy & Cloud / Network Security Contribute to enterprise security architecture planning under the direction of the Sr. Manager, Information Security Operations.
  • Provide security guidance to infrastructure, network, and cloud teams to ensure secure-by-design solutions.
  • Improve HOOPP’s cloud security posture, with a strong emphasis on AWS (Azure experience is an asset).
  • Design, implement, and monitor secure cloud and hybrid network architectures, including segmentation, firewalling, routing, and secure connectivity.
  • Balance security best practices with operational and business requirements.
  • Security Tooling & Engineering Govern and enhance core security services, including SIEM, email security, endpoint protection, vulnerability management, and network security tools.
  • Lead or support the deployment, integration, and configuration of new security technologies.
  • Drive automation and orchestration to improve operational efficiency and security outcomes.
  • Maintain secure configuration baselines and participate in vulnerability assessments, penetration testing, audits, and vendor security assessments
